Step 4 — Enable dark mode on the Corvette Admin Dashboard. Flip THEME_DARK_ENABLED=true in the env file and redeploy the frontend pod; no database migration needed. Heads up: the palette assets come from our theming service, so if icons look washed out, clear the CDN cache before panicking. The dashboard authenticates to the theming service with a token it reads at startup. Add that token on the line right after this step.

vault entry, fadup-baguf: VAULT_KEY3=0e7

## Session Handling — AgriLink Gateway

The AgriLink telemetry gateway authenticates each tractor-mounted unit via a short-lived session established over mutual TLS. Sessions expire after 15 minutes of inactivity; the gateway rejects replayed nonces and rotates signing keys daily. Field units in the Harrowfen pilot region fall back to a queued-upload mode when offline, resuming the same session only if the token remains valid. For reviewer verification against the staging cluster, use the bearer token below.

login token, bagug-kafop: eyJhbGciOiJIUzI1NiIsInR5cCI6IkpXVCJ9.eyJzdWIiOiIcMLov2In0.Z5RLDIfp

Subject: Handover — Pointsmith ledger

Hi Verena,

Taking over the Pointsmith loyalty-points ledger from me as of Friday. Nightly reconciliation runs at 02:10 and compares earned versus redeemed totals per member; discrepancies land in the `ledger_variance` table and should be triaged within a day. Schema migrations go through the usual review queue. For read access during reviews, use the replica reachable via the connection string below.

Thanks,
Otso

primary connection of yagep-kahip = redis://giliel_svc:zYiKsLL2PLpfPL@db-348f.xolmarsys.corp:5432/fenwyn

## Changelog — Ticktrace 1.9

### Renamed: DRIFT_API_TOKEN
During the cron drift investigation we found plugins confusing this variable with the metrics token, so it has been renamed to indicate it authorizes drift-report uploads specifically. Plugin authors must read the new name from 1.9 onward; the old name is ignored without warning. Sample env files in the SDK are updated. In your deployment env file, the drift-report upload secret is set on the next line.

env line for fawef-taguf: VAULT_KEY13=a9695905a9a90